matlab实验五答案

matlab实验五答案

ID:40564019

大小:115.00 KB

页数:5页

时间:2019-08-04

matlab实验五答案_第1页
matlab实验五答案_第2页
matlab实验五答案_第3页
matlab实验五答案_第4页
matlab实验五答案_第5页
资源描述:

《matlab实验五答案》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、实验五频域分析法一、实验目的1.掌握控制系统频域分析的基本方法;2.掌握控制系统PID设计方法。二、实验内容1.已知二阶环节,分别绘制时的Bode图。程序:clc;clear;closeallw=[0,logspace(-2,2,200)]wn=0.7tou=[0.1,0.4,1.0,1.6,2.0]%阻尼比的不同值forj=1:5sys=tf([wn*wn],[1,2*tou(j)*wn,wn*wn])bode(sys,w);holdonendgtext('tou=0.1');%tou去不同的文字注释gtext('tou=0.

2、4');gtext('tou=1.0');gtext('tou=1.6');gtext('tou=2.0');2.已知系统开环传递函数,试求系统的,并绘制Bode图。程序:clcclearcloseallnum=5*[0.0167,1];den=conv(conv([1,0],[0.03,1]),conv([0.0025,1],[0.001,1]));G=tf(num,den);w=logspace(0,4,50);bode(G,w)grid[Gm,Pm,Wcg,WcP]=margin(G)Gm=455.2548Pm=85.27

3、51Wcg=602.4232WcP=4.96203.已知单位负反馈系统开环传递函数为:,分别绘制该系统的Nyquist图和Bode图。程序:(1)Nyquist图:clcclearcloseallnum=[5];den=[1314921];G=tf(num,den)%ngrid%Nichols图绘制删格ngrid('new')%Nichols图绘制删格线,并设置holdonnichols(G)(2)Bode图:clcclearcloseallnum=[5];den=[1314921];G=tf(num,den)bode(G)gr

4、id4.己知系统的开环传递函数为:试绘制系统的极坐标图,并利用Nyquist稳定判据判断闭环系统的稳定性。程序:clc;clear;closeallk=100;z=[-5];p=[2,-8,-20];G=zpk(z,p,k)nyquist(G)grid逆时针包围(-1,j0)点圈数1,由Nyquist稳定判据知,闭环系统稳定。5.例8-5截图:二、收获体会通过这次实验,我掌握控制系统频域分析的基本方法以及系统PID设计方法。加深了对MATLAB的认识。

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。